The momentum behind women’s flag football
The sport is not just growing — it is being institutionalized. That creates real opportunity for the athletes who are building their skills right now.
2020
NCAA Emerging Sports
Women’s flag football added to the NCAA Emerging Sports for Women program, signaling long-term investment.
2021
NAIA recognition
The NAIA recognizes women’s flag football, hosting invitational championships and creating scholarship pathways.
2023
NJCAA championship
The NJCAA launches its first national championship, expanding access to two-year college programs.
